#3662bf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3662bf is composed of 21.2% red, 38.4%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.7% cyan, 48.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 220.7 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 48%. #3662bf color hex could be obtained by blending #6cc4ff with #00007f.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

● #3662bf color description : Moderate blue.
#3662bf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3662bf has RGB values of R:54, G:98,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 3564223.

Shades and Tints of #3662bf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020407 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3662bf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787a7d is the less saturated color, while #0751ee is the most saturated one.
